Setup & Connectivity Guide

Quick Setup Tips: The projector is designed for minimal configuration. Simply unpack, unfold the 80-inch screen, connect your desired device via HDMI or USB, and adjust focus and zoom as needed. The included HDMI cable makes connecting laptops and streaming devices straightforward.

Smartphone Connection: iOS devices require an official Lightning to HDMI adapter (sold separately), while Android devices with MHL support can use a micro USB or USB-C to HDMI cable. If your phone lacks MHL support, use Chromecast for wireless streaming.

Streaming Apps: Due to HDCP protection, Netflix, Prime Video, and Hulu cannot be screen mirrored directly. Instead, connect a Fire TV Stick, Roku device, or Chromecast to the projector's HDMI port to access these services seamlessly.

Audio Enhancement: Pair Bluetooth speakers or soundbars for superior audio, or enable Bluetooth speaker mode to stream music directly from your phone or tablet without video display.

Choosing the Right Projector Screen for Your Apartment

Prioritize Portability and Storage

Your apartment likely has limited storage space. Look for screens that are lightweight and include a dedicated carry bag. Foldable designs, like the Mdbebbron 120 inch Projector Screen 16:9 Foldable, compress down for easy tucking into a closet or under a bed. Screens with integrated, collapsible stands offer an all-in-one solution that avoids the need for wall mounting entirely.

Consider Setup Ease and Flexibility

Tool-free assembly is a major advantage for renters. Many modern stands use simple locking mechanisms and elastic cords for quick setup. You want a screen you can deploy in your living room for movie night and disassemble just as fast. Models that support both front and rear projection also give you more flexibility in arranging your furniture and projector placement within a confined space.

Evaluate Screen Material and Performance

Apartments are not always ideal for complete darkness. Screens with ambient light rejecting (ALR) properties, like the Projector Screen with Stand from VISULAPEX, can significantly improve contrast and color vibrancy in rooms with some ambient light from windows or lamps. A wrinkle-free fabric is also crucial for a pristine image without the need for complex tensioning systems.

Match Size to Your Space

Bigger is not always better in a small apartment. Measure your available wall space or the area where you plan to place a stand. A 100-inch or 120-inch screen often provides an immersive experience without overwhelming the room. Remember to check the footprint of a standing screen to ensure it fits comfortably in your viewing area. Frequently Asked Questions

Can I use a projector screen without drilling holes in my apartment wall? Absolutely. Many screens designed for apartments use tension rods, adhesive hooks, or command strips for temporary mounting. Freestanding models with tripods, like the TOWOND 120 Inch Outdoor Projector Screen with 4K, are completely non-invasive and can be placed anywhere with adequate floor space.

What is the best screen size for a typical living room? For most apartment living rooms, a screen between 100 and 120 inches diagonal offers a fantastic, immersive experience without dominating the space. It provides a large viewing area that feels cinematic while still allowing for comfortable seating distance and room navigation.

Do I need a special screen for a 4K projector? While you can project onto any flat surface, a screen designed for 4K or HD content will have a tighter weave and better gain to fully resolve the detail and color from your projector. How do I prevent my portable screen from looking wrinkled? Look for screens marketed as anti-crease or wrinkle-free, which use specific fabrics and tensioning borders. These materials are designed to lay flat even after being folded for storage. Properly rolling or folding the screen along its seams as instructed also helps maintain a smooth surface.
